7 Ways Natural Light Benefits Our Health

Natural light is a buzz word amongst real estate agents, and for good reason. The benefits that natural light can provide a residential or commercial space span beyond brightening up the space and making it look good; it can impact our health in ways we don’t even realize.

Many of us would love to spend more time outdoors, but work commitments and weather conditions require us to spend most of the day indoors. Office workers, whether spending the day working from home or working in the office, prefer natural sunlight over florescent lights. Many even find it to be a requirement for productivity.

We know choosing the right windows is an important design decision for your residential or commercial space, but it can go as far as benefitting our health. Below are 7 ways natural light benefits our health.

  1. Reduce Stress and Anxiety

Natural sunlight can increase melatonin levels, which leads to reduced stress and anxiety. Having strategically placed windows and doors in your home or office can help to reduce daily stressors by soaking in the natural sunlight that shines through.

  1. Improve Sleep

Better sleep is achieved when our circadian rhythm is regulated. But how can we regulate our circadian rhythm? More access to natural light. When we let the bright light in in the morning or get exposed to more natural light during the day, our bodies will naturally signal when it’s time to go to sleep at night.

  1. Exposure to Vitamin D

We naturally produce Vitamin D when exposed to sunlight. Vitamin D provides many health benefits, including maintaining strong bones and reducing inflammation. It also boosts immunity, which leads us to our next health benefit.

  1. Boost Immune System

Healthy immune systems can fight off illnesses and infections, which is a priority now more than ever in the wake of the Coronavirus pandemic. Windows that provide a lot of natural light offer consistent exposure to Vitamin D, which can help support immune health.

  1. Battle Seasonal Depression

The winter blues are a reality many people face, but exposure to natural light can help. When the days get shorter and the weather is overall much drearier in the winter months, natural light can ease the symptoms of seasonal depression. Exposure to sunlight increases serotonin levels, which increases your mood.

  1. Enhance Mood, Productivity, Focus

All the benefits of a successful day are achieved through increased serotonin levels, which provide enhanced mood, productivity, and focus. When we have a heightened sense of alertness, it’s easier to take on daily tasks and activities.

  1. Reduce Eye Strain

Prolonged exposure to artificial lighting has been known to cause eye strain, which is why having more windows that provide natural light in the room can be better for your eyes. We all know the feeling of being on our computers, laptops or smartphones for long periods of time and how that can impact our eyes. More natural light exposure can combat eye strain and help your vision.
